The Role of Laws in Society
Laws serve as the backbone of societal order. They provide a framework for acceptable behavior and outline the consequences for violations. The impact of laws can be observed in various aspects of life, including:
- Maintaining public order and safety.
- Protecting individual rights and freedoms.
- Promoting social justice and equality.
- Regulating economic activities.
Enforcement of Laws
Enforcement is a critical component of the legal system. It involves the mechanisms through which laws are applied and upheld. Effective enforcement ensures that laws are not merely theoretical but have tangible effects on society. Key elements of law enforcement include:
- Law enforcement agencies, such as police and regulatory bodies.
- The judicial system, which interprets and applies laws.
- Community involvement in upholding laws.
- Use of technology in monitoring and enforcing compliance.
Law Enforcement Agencies
Law enforcement agencies are the frontline defenders of the law. They are responsible for investigating crimes, apprehending offenders, and ensuring that laws are followed. The effectiveness of these agencies can significantly influence public perception of the law.
The Judicial System
The judicial system interprets laws and adjudicates disputes. Courts play a vital role in ensuring justice is served and that laws are applied fairly. The independence of the judiciary is essential for maintaining public trust in the legal system.
Compliance with Laws
Compliance refers to the degree to which individuals and organizations adhere to laws. Understanding the factors that influence compliance is crucial for effective law enforcement. Key factors include:
- Awareness of laws and regulations.
- Perceived legitimacy of the law.
- Consequences of non-compliance.
- Social norms and peer influence.
Awareness of Laws
Public awareness of laws is essential for compliance. Educational initiatives can help inform citizens about their rights and responsibilities, thereby fostering a culture of lawfulness.
Perceived Legitimacy
The perceived legitimacy of laws significantly impacts compliance. If individuals view laws as fair and just, they are more likely to adhere to them. Conversely, laws perceived as unjust may lead to resistance and non-compliance.
Challenges in Law Enforcement and Compliance
Despite the importance of law enforcement and compliance, several challenges can hinder their effectiveness. These challenges include:
- Resource limitations for law enforcement agencies.
- Corruption within the legal system.
- Public distrust in authorities.
- Complexity of laws leading to confusion.
Resource Limitations
Many law enforcement agencies face budget constraints that limit their ability to operate effectively. Insufficient resources can lead to inadequate training, staffing shortages, and insufficient technology.
Corruption
Corruption within the legal system can undermine the enforcement of laws. When individuals perceive that laws are applied selectively or unfairly, it can erode trust and lead to non-compliance.
Strategies for Improving Enforcement and Compliance
To enhance the effectiveness of law enforcement and promote compliance, several strategies can be implemented:
- Increasing public education and awareness campaigns.
- Strengthening community policing initiatives.
- Enhancing transparency and accountability in law enforcement.
- Leveraging technology for monitoring and enforcement.
Public Education and Awareness
Educational campaigns can inform the public about laws and their implications. By fostering a better understanding of legal frameworks, citizens may be more inclined to comply with regulations.
Community Policing
Community policing emphasizes building relationships between law enforcement and the communities they serve. This approach can enhance trust and cooperation, leading to improved compliance with laws.
